In this memoir, we prove that the universal Teichmuller space $T(1)$ carries a new structure of a complex Hilbert manifold and show that the connected component of the identity of $T(1)$ -- the Hilbert submanifold $T {0 (1)$ -- is a topological group. We define a Weil-Petersson metric on $T(1)$ by Hilbert space inner products on tangent spaces, compute its Riemann curvature tensor, and show that $T(1)$ is a Kahler-Einstein manifold with negative Ricci and sectional curvatures. We introduce and compute Mumford-Miller-Morita characteristic forms for the vertical tangent bundle of the universal Teichmuller curve fibration over the universal Teichmuller space. As an application, we derive Wolpert curvature formulas for the finite-dimensional Teichmuller spaces from the formulas for the universal Teichmuller space. This proceedings is a collection of articles on Topology and Teichmüller Spaces. Special emphasis is being put on the universal Teichmüller space, the topology of moduli of algebraic curves, the space of representations of discrete groups, Kleinian groups and Dehn filling deformations, the geometry of Riemann surfaces, and some related topics.

The main purpose of this paper is to prove the existence, and in some cases the uniqueness, of unitarily invariant measures on formal completions of groups associated to affine Kac-Moody algebras, and associated homogeneous spaces. The basic invariant measure is a natural generalization of Haar measure for a simply connected compact Lie group, and its projection to flag spaces is a generalization of the normalized invariant volume element. The other "invariant measures" are actually measures having values in line bundles over these spaces; these bundle-valued measures heuristically arise from coupling the basic invariant measure to Hermitian structures on associated line bundles, but in this infinite dimensional setting they are generally singular with respect to the basic invariant measure.

The Teichmüller space T(X) is the space of marked conformal structures on a given quasiconformal surface X. This volume uses quasiconformal mapping to give a unified and up-to-date treatment of T(X). Emphasis is placed on parts of the theory applicable to noncompact surfaces and to surfaces possibly of infinite analytic type. The book provides a treatment of deformations of complex structures on infinite Riemann surfaces and gives background for further research in many areas. These include applications to fractal geometry, to three-dimensional manifolds through its relationship to Kleinian groups, and to one-dimensional dynamics through its relationship to quasisymmetric mappings. Many research problems in the application of function theory to geometry and dynamics are suggested.

An accessible, self-contained treatment of the complex structure of the Teichmüller moduli spaces of Riemann surfaces. Complex analysts, geometers, and especially string theorists (!) will find this work indispensable. The Teichmüller space, parametrizing all the various complex structures on a given surface, itself carries (in a completely natural way) the complex structure of a finite- or infinite-dimensional complex manifold. Nag emphasizes the Bers embedding of Teichmüller spaces and deals with various types of complex-analytic coördinates for them. This is the first book in which a complete exposition is given of the most basic fact that the Bers projection from Beltrami differentials onto Teichmüller space is a complex analytic submersion. The fundamental universal property enjoyed by Teichmüller space is given two proofs and the Bers complex boundary is examined to the point where totally degenerate Kleinian groups make their spectacular appearance.
